In what ways can companies ensure that their customer experience team is not only celebrating diversity, but also actively advocating for inclusivity within their organization and beyond?
Companies can ensure that their customer experience team is celebrating diversity and advocating for inclusivity by implementing diversity training programs, promoting open communication and collaboration among team members, and creating a safe and inclusive work environment. They can also encourage team members to participate in diversity and inclusion initiatives both within the organization and in the community, and provide resources and support for team members to educate themselves on issues related to diversity and inclusivity. Additionally, companies can hold their customer experience team accountable for promoting diversity and inclusivity by setting clear goals and measuring progress towards creating a more inclusive workplace and customer experience.
